**UCP/Personal Support Worker**

Responsible for providing practical personal care and social support to residents with the goal of maintaining their personal independence, good health and well being.

**Responsibilities**:

- Performs those functions which provide for the support and care of residents with an acceptable standard of skill, with a sense of responsibility and respect for privacy and dignity.
- Assists in the process of observing, reporting and documenting the changes in the residents’ physical and emotional condition.
- Implement the plans of care for assigned residents as outlined by the Director of Care, and provides input into care plans.
- Documents as per the home’s policies.
- Promotes comfort and safety for the residents.
- Promotes independence and wellness.
- Maintains effective communication and good human relations with residents, families and staff of other departments, using the appropriate lines of communication.
